Gender pay gap
In the 2025/26 reporting year, women's median hourly pay here was 4.4% lower than men's (500 to 999 employees).
That puts it around the middle of the pack for pay parity — closer to an equal median than 65% of the 9,642 employers who reported for 2025/26. See the pay gap league table.
All 9,642 reporting employers for 2025/26 by median gap. 0 is equal pay; bars right of it are employers where men's median pay is higher, bars left of it where women's is.
The gap has narrowed since the 5.8% reported for 2017/18.
| Year | Median gap | Mean gap | Bonus gap | Women in top pay quartile | Women in lowest |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2025/26 | 4.4% | 12% | 11.3% | 12.5% | 30.8% |
| 2024/25 | 5% | 17.2% | -3.3% | 11% | 31.5% |
| 2023/24 | 5.8% | 17% | 27.1% | 10.5% | 27.7% |
| 2022/23 | 2.3% | 16.2% | 33.1% | 11.6% | 25.9% |
| 2021/22 | 1.3% | 12.4% | 31.4% | 12.6% | 26.8% |
| 2020/21 | 14.5% | 18.2% | 24% | 8.6% | 27.8% |
| 2019/20 | 8.7% | 17% | -28% | 7.1% | 28.3% |
| 2018/19 | 13.3% | 16.4% | -8% | 7.8% | 28.5% |
| 2017/18 | 5.8% | 15.9% | 0% | 8.1% | 25.3% |
